(02/07/2013 12:48)MPTE1955 Wrote: Remember the H-GPF City buses that used go work the 60, anybody remember which ones were here as I am down in Norwich this week and have seen H653 GPF & H689 GPF working norwich schools. Were either of these two here. Thanking you in advance. The B10M/East Lancs deckers based at Bootle were ArrNW 3691 (H661 GPF), 3692 (H662 GPF) and 3697 (H667 GPF). They were all ex-London and Country. They had stumpy rear ends (the North Western Citybuses were more elegant in this respect) and ugly-looking oblong headlamps, which East Lancs insisted on using throughout the 1990s (the CityPLUS EL2000 Darts 1217-1264 also used these lights). 3697 at Queen Square nine years' ago.... http://www.flickr.com/photos/33216596@N02/4489547007 (Photo Credit; Steven Hughes) 3697 went to Northern Blue (as did 3691) and was scrapped in 2008. An unhappy Christmas Day.... ![]() http://www.flickr.com/photos/87583925@N00/3135923686 (Photo Credit; Andrew Stopford) 3692 didn't fair much better, going to Dunn Line before getting stripped (then scrapped) at Ensign.... http://www.flickr.com/photos/46341292@N05/5287619833 (Photo Credit; RMC1490) Happily, 3691 still survives (its on SORN until March '14 according to DVLA). As seen here with Northern Blue.... http://www.flickr.com/photos/22694662@N06/2968714185 (Photo Credit; Ian Simpson). |
